The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 1997 Jefferson Rivanna is a classic houseboat known for its spacious design and comfortable living areas. Here are some p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Spacious Layout: The Rivanna offers generous interior space, making it ideal for extended stays and entertaining guests.
Traditional Styling: Its classic design appeals to those who appreciate a timeless, elegant look in a houseboat.
Solid Construction: Built with quality materials, the 1997 model is known for durability and reliable performance on the water.
Functional Amenities: Equipped with essential features and conveniences for comfortable living, including a well-appointed galley and ample storage.
Cons
Older Model: Being a 1997 build, some systems and components may require updating or maintenance to meet modern standards.
Fuel Efficiency: Compared to newer boats, the Rivanna may have less fuel-efficient engines, leading to higher operating costs.
Limited Modern Technology: Lacks some of the contemporary electronics and smart features found on newer houseboats.
Size Considerations: While spacious, its size might limit maneuverability in tighter waterways or marinas.
